Cost of Parking Lot Land Clearing in Norwalk
Clearing land for a parking lot in Norwalk, CT, involves various factors that can influence the overall cost. From the type of vegetation to the size of the lot, each element plays a crucial role in determining the final expenses. Understanding these factors can help you budget more effectively for your project.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Size of the Lot: Larger lots require more time and resources to clear.
- Type of Vegetation: Dense forests or heavy underbrush can increase costs due to the need for specialized equipment.
- Terrain: Uneven or rocky terrain may require additional work and machinery.
- Permits and Regulations: Local permits and environmental regulations can add to the overall expense.
- Accessibility: Easily accessible lots are usually cheaper to clear compared to those in remote or hard-to-reach areas.
- Disposal of Debris: The method and distance for debris disposal can significantly affect costs.
- Labor Costs: Local labor rates in Norwalk, CT, can vary and impact the overall c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Norwalk, CT) |
---|---|
Tree Removal | $500 - $1,000 per tree |
Stump Grinding | $150 - $300 per stump |
Brush Clearing | $1,200 - $4,000 per acre |
Grading and Leveling | $1,000 - $2,500 per acre |
Debris Removal | $300 - $600 per load |
Permit Fees | $200 - $500 |
Soil Testing | $800 - $1,200 |
